BoxCast is a leading broadcast media company that has established itself as a pioneering force in the industry since its founding in 2013. Headquartered in Cleveland, Ohio, United States, BoxCast boasts a talented team of 51-200 dedicated professionals who work tirelessly to provide innovative solutions for churches and other organizations seeking to elevate their online presence.
At the heart of BoxCast's success is its cutting-edge video platform, designed to empower users to connect and engage with their communities like never before. This comprehensive platform offers a range of features and functionalities that cater specifically to the needs of churches and faith-based organizations.
With expert support and guidance from BoxCast's team, users can create, manage, and distribute high-quality video content across various channels and platforms. The company's integrated system seamlessly integrates with popular video sharing sites, social media platforms, and streaming services, ensuring maximum visibility and reach for users' content.
